What this means

Status 702 means the registration is active, Section 8 was accepted, and a Section 15 declaration of incontestability was also accepted. Incontestability strengthens your rights by limiting certain challenges after five years of continuous use. Continue use in commerce and plan for the 10-year Section 8 and 9 renewal.
